gpt4 book ai didi

python - 如何在 Microsoft Windows 10 中使用 pyenv/pyenv-win 安装 python 版本?

转载 作者:行者123 更新时间:2023-12-02 19:31:50 29 4
gpt4 key购买 nike

TLDR

我无法使用 pyenv-win 安装 3.6.10,只能安装 3.6.8 ref .

虽然我无法使用pyenv global让它成为全局python版本ref

详细信息

我按照指导安装了 pyenv-win here并失败,输出如下。既然您知道修复方法,请分享。

附:我还将这个发布在 pyenv-win github home here

:: [ERROR] :: 404 :: file not found

我的完整命令和输出如下

PS C:\Users\namgivu> pyenv install 3.6.10
:: [Info] :: Mirror: https://www.python.org/ftp/python
:: [Downloading] :: 3.6.10 ...
:: [Downloading] :: From https://www.python.org/ftp/python/3.6.10/python-3.6.10.exe
:: [Downloading] :: To C:\Users\namgivu\.pyenv\pyenv-win\install_cache\python-3.6.10.exe
:: [ERROR] :: 404 :: file not found

用3.6.8重试,可以成功;虽然不能 pyenv global 将其设置为让我的 Windows 操作系统全局使用此 3.6.8,而不是以前安装的 3.7.7。这个问题还待讨论here

PS C:\Users\namgivu> pyenv install 3.6.8
:: [Info] :: Mirror: https://www.python.org/ftp/python
:: [Downloading] :: 3.6.8 ...
:: [Downloading] :: From https://www.python.org/ftp/python/3.6.8/python-3.6.8.exe
:: [Downloading] :: To C:\Users\namgivu\.pyenv\pyenv-win\install_cache\python-3.6.8.exe
:: [Installing] :: 3.6.8 ...
:: [Info] :: completed! 3.6.8
PS C:\Users\namgivu> pyenv global 3.6.8
PS C:\Users\namgivu> python -V
Python 3.7.7

最佳答案

Python 3.6.93.6.10仅作为源代码发布 - 没有适用于 Windows 的编译版本。

您可能希望自己编译它,但在此之前,请阅读此 related thread 中的好建议。 .


pyenv global 命令的旁注

pyenv install之后,我们需要在将其设置为全局/本地之前调用pyenv rehash,如所讨论的here

PS C:\Users\namgivu> pyenv global 3.7.6; pyenv rehash; python -V
Python 3.7.6
PS C:\Users\namgivu> pyenv global 3.6.8; pyenv rehash; python -V
Python 3.6.8

关于python - 如何在 Microsoft Windows 10 中使用 pyenv/pyenv-win 安装 python 版本?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61673321/

29 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com